So entfernen Sie das Gebietsschema in Linux Mint
Standardmäßig enthält Linux Mint eine Reihe zusätzlicher Gebietsschemas, die Sie höchstwahrscheinlich nicht benötigen. Beim Aktualisieren von Systemkomponenten wie libc oder Kernel erstellt das Betriebssystem diese neu. Dieser Vorgang nimmt eine beträchtliche Zeit in Anspruch und ist in der Tat völlig überflüssig. Sehen wir uns an, wie Sie diese zusätzlichen Gebietsschemas entfernen können.
Werbung
Ich bin mit nur zwei Gebietsschemata zufrieden, en_US.UTF-8 und ru_RU.UTF-8. Meine Neuinstallation von Mint 18.1 hat jedoch eine Reihe zusätzlicher Gebietsschemas. Sehen wir uns an, welche Gebietsschemas standardmäßig installiert sind.
Öffnen Sie Ihre bevorzugte Terminalemulator-App und geben Sie den folgenden Befehl ein:
Gebietsschema -a
Dadurch wird die Liste der installierten Gebietsschemas ausgefüllt. So sieht es aus.
Wie Sie sehen, gibt es neben dem erforderlichen auch viele installierte Gebietsschemas. Mal sehen, wie man sie loswird.
So entfernen Sie ein Gebietsschema in Linux Mint, Mach Folgendes.
Öffnen Sie ein neues Root-Terminal. Bitte beachten Sie den folgenden Artikel:
So öffnen Sie das Root-Terminal in Linux Mint
Gebietsschemas werden in Textdateien unter /var/lib/locales/supported.d/ definiert. Abhängig von Ihrer Betriebssystemkonfiguration kann es mehr als eine Datei geben. Jede Datei kann eine oder mehrere Locales enthalten, die installiert werden. Sie können diese Dateien bearbeiten und Ihre Gebietsschemaliste neu generieren.
In meinem Fall muss ich nur eine Datei ändern, /var/lib/locales/supported.d/en. Bearbeiten wir es, um die Konfiguration zu ändern.
Öffnen Sie die Datei mit Ihrem bevorzugten Texteditor, z.B.
nano /var/lib/locales/supported.d/en
oder
vim /var/lib/locales/supported.d/en

In meinem Fall muss ich alle Zeilen in dieser Datei entfernen und nur das Element en_US.UTF-8 behalten.

Entfernen Sie die unnötigen Zeilen und speichern Sie die Datei.
Führen Sie nun den folgenden Befehl als root aus:
Gebietsschema
Dadurch werden nur die erforderlichen Gebietsschemas erstellt. Die anderen Locales werden nicht mehr generiert.
Sie können auch alle Gebietsschemas löschen, die von der vorherigen Einrichtung übrig geblieben sind.
Führen Sie den folgenden Befehl als root aus, um sie zu entfernen
locale-gen --purge ru_RU.UTF-8 en_US.UTF-8
Dadurch werden nur zwei Gebietsschemas ru_RU.UTF-8 und en_US.UTF-8 beibehalten. Alles andere wird entfernt.
Du bist fertig.